9. Koe no Katachi (A Silent Voice)
Japanese: 聲の形
Status: Completed 
Genre(s): Comedy, Drama, Romance, School Life, Shounen, Slice Of Life
Number of Chapters: 62
Author: Ooima Yoshitoki

Summary:
Ishida Shouya bullies a deaf girl, Nishimiya Shouko, to the point that she drops out of school. As a result, he is ostracized and bullied himself with no friends to speak of and no plans for the future.

This is the story of his path to redemption.

8. Noragami (Stray God)
Japanese: ノラガミ
Status: Ongoing
Genre(s): Action, Adventure, Romance, Shounen, Supernatural
Number of Chapters: currently 48
Author: Adachi Toka

Summary:
Yato is a minor god whose dream is to have a lot of followers worshipping him and praying to him. Unfortunately, his dream is far from coming true since he doesn't even have a single shrine dedicated to him. To make things worse, the only partner he had to help him solve people's problems, had just quit the job.

His godly existence and luck just might change when he stumbles upon Iki Hiyori and saves her life; a feat which also leaves her in quite a predicament so she is stuck with him until her problem gets resolved. Together with Hiyori and his new partner-weapon Yukine, Yato will do everything he can to gain fame, recognition and just maybe, one shrine dedicated to him, as well.


Thoughts:
Noragami is a very wonderful, humorous, and heartwarming manga about a minor deity god named Yato. He was once a person with a very dark and mysterious past, and so he does his best to make people acknowledge him and all his hardwork. It's funny and sort of fluffy, and it's really worth reading.

4. Orange

Japanese: オレンジ
Status: Ongoing
Number of Chapters: currently 16
Genre(s): Drama, Romance, School, Sci-Fi, Shoujo
Author: Takano Ichigo

Summary:
One day, Takamiya Naho receives a letter written to herself from ten years in the future. As Naho reads on, the letter recites the exact events of the day, including the transfer of a new student into her class named Naruse Kakeru.

The Naho from ten years later repeatedly states that she has many regrets, and she wants to fix these by making sure the Naho from the past can make the right decisions—especially regarding Kakeru. What's more shocking is that she discovers that ten years later, Kakeru will no longer be with them. Future Naho asks her to watch over him closely.

3. Naruto

Japanese: ナルト
Status: Finished
Number of Chapters: 700
Genre(s): Action, Adventure, Drama, Martial Arts, Shounen, Superpower
Author: Masashi Kishimoto

Summary:
Before Naruto's birth, a great demon fox had attacked the Hidden Leaf Village. A man known as the 4th Hokage sealed the demon inside the newly born Naruto, causing him to unknowingly grow up detested by his fellow villagers. Despite his lack of talent in many areas of ninjutsu, Naruto strives for only one goal: to gain the title of Hokage, the strongest ninja in his village. Desiring the respect he never received, Naruto works toward his dream with fellow friends Sasuke and Sakura and mentor Kakashi as they go through many trials and battles that come with being a ninja.

2. Watashitachi no Shiawase na Jikan (Our Happy Time)

Japanese: 私たちの幸せな時間
Status: Finished
Number of Chapters: 8
Genre(s): Drama, Romance, Seinen, Slice of Life, Josei, Psychological
Author: Yumeka Sumomo (Art) and Gong Ji-Young (Story)

Summary:
"I have something I don't want to lose"

"So much so that these terrible feelings have grown."

A pianist who attempted suicide 3 times, Juri, is taken to help her aunt at a prison where murderers who killed indiscriminately are sentenced to death. There, she meets a man named Yuu who took the lives of 3 people. A mother's antagonism--a brother's death... Together they embrace the violent rebellion in their hearts caused by the large, deep scars they carry. However, before long, they both embrace an earnest hope in their hearts. "I want to live..."

1. Tokyo Ghoul (Toukyou Kushu)
Japanese: 東京喰種-トーキョーグール-
Status: Finished
Genre(s): Horror, Psychological, Drama, Seinen
Number of Chapters: 143
Author: Ishida Sui

Summary:
Strange murders are happening in Tokyo. Due to liquid evidence at the scene, the police conclude the attacks are the results of "eater" type ghouls. College buddies Kaneki and Hide come up with the idea that ghouls are imitating humans so that's why they haven't ever seen one. Little did they know that their theory may very well become reality.
